Solar Power Satellites Fundamentals: The Next Frontier Training by Tonex

Solar Power Satellites Fundamentals The Next Frontier Training by Tonex

Solar power satellites (SPS) offer a revolutionary way to harness solar energy from space and transmit it to Earth. This training provides a comprehensive overview of SPS concepts, technologies, and applications. Participants will explore energy transmission methods, orbital mechanics, and system design considerations. The course covers the challenges and opportunities of space-based solar power, including economic feasibility and policy implications. Gain insights into the latest advancements shaping the future of SPS. Learn how SPS can contribute to global energy needs and sustainability. Course Modules:

Module 1: Introduction to Solar Power Satellites

  • Overview of solar power satellite concepts
  • History and evolution of space-based solar power
  • Key components of SPS systems
  • Comparison with terrestrial solar power solutions
  • Benefits and challenges of SPS technology
  • Current research and development efforts

Module 2: Energy Collection and Transmission

  • Photovoltaic and solar thermal power generation in space
  • Wireless power transmission technologies
  • Microwave vs. laser energy transmission methods
  • Efficiency and power loss considerations
  • Safety and environmental impact of energy transmission
  • Case studies on experimental SPS projects

Module 3: Orbital Mechanics and Deployment

  • Optimal orbits for solar power satellites
  • Geostationary vs. low Earth orbit positioning
  • Launch and assembly methods for SPS systems
  • Maintaining alignment and power transmission accuracy
  • Space debris and operational risk management
  • Future trends in satellite deployment for energy generation

Module 4: System Design and Engineering Challenges

  • Structural design of large-scale SPS systems
  • Thermal management in space environments
  • Power management and storage solutions
  • Integration with terrestrial power grids
  • Advances in lightweight materials for SPS structures
  • Redundancy and reliability in SPS architectures

Module 5: Economic and Policy Considerations

  • Cost analysis of SPS development and deployment
  • Government policies and international regulations
  • Market potential and investment opportunities
  • Public perception and acceptance of SPS technology
  • Energy security and geopolitical implications
  • Collaboration between public and private sectors

Module 6: Future of Space-Based Solar Power

  • Emerging innovations in SPS technology
  • Role of artificial intelligence in SPS operations
  • Potential applications beyond Earth’s energy grid
  • Space-based energy solutions for lunar and Martian colonies
  • Roadmap for commercializing SPS technology
  • Strategic initiatives for global energy sustainability
